Directly under the lower intake manifold. the connection for this sensor is below the throttle body. If replacing sensor the sub harness should be replaced as well. Assuming it is a V-6 it is directly under the lower intake manifold. connection can be found under throttle body.

The manufacturer states throttle body and the intake manifold must be removed to access the knock sensor. The knock sensor is located on side of cylinder block.
If you have the 7MGE engine: Then the knock sensor is screwed into the engine block, directly underneath the intake manifold.

The "knock sensors" for the Avalon 3.0 are facing the firewall on the engine block just below the cylinder head ,their are two knock sensors .
Sienna's have two knock sensors located in the valley underneath the intake manifold. Replacement is a three hour job.
